Always looking for ways to give back to the community in which I serve, I recently extended my hand to a family whose patriarch had just completed serving his country overseas this past December. It all began when I was contacted by Tonya who explained to me that her husband was coming home after a seven-month deployment to Camp Pendleton. She expressed that she wanted to utilize my Orange County photography services in order to have pictures taken for the homecoming.

When she asked what this type of photography session would cost I let her know that it would cost nothing and that she should consider it my thank you gift for her husbands service to our country. Initially Tonya wasn't sure whether her husband would arrive on December 17 or December 18 but I told her that regardless of when he arrives that I would be there to take pictures of the homecoming.

Tonya's husband actually arrived on December 17 and I arrived at the local Rotary at about 8:30 AM. While we waited we enjoyed some hot chocolate, munchies and watched the happy reunions of other soldiers returning home. Tonya's husband Tyler finally arrived at 10:30 AM and the Orange County photographs I took of this happy family reunion will not only provide Tonya and her family with printed memories but will remain in my mind for the rest of my life.
